/*
* pwmControl:
* Allow the user to control some of the PWM functions
*********************************************************************************
*/
void pwmSetModeWPi (int mode)
{
if (mode == PWM_MODE_MS)
*(pwm + PWM_CONTROL) = PWM0_ENABLE | PWM1_ENABLE | PWM0_MS_MODE | PWM1_MS_MODE ;
else
*(pwm + PWM_CONTROL) = PWM0_ENABLE | PWM1_ENABLE ;
}
void pwmSetModeSys (int mode)
{
return ;
}
void pwmSetRangeWPi (unsigned int range)
{
*(pwm + PWM0_RANGE) = range ; delayMicroseconds (10) ;
*(pwm + PWM1_RANGE) = range ; delayMicroseconds (10) ;
}
void pwmSetRangeSys (unsigned int range)
{
return ;
}
